Oooohhhh......The Behringer debate! This could get ugly

Behringer has its place...and it also has its sound/sonic qualities. One interview I read this guy loved his obscenely cheap Behringer preamp, cos it sounded real dirty and Lo-fi......so It had a purpose.

The assumption that all Behringer gear is shithouse cos it is made in china and is dirt cheap is a dangerous one. For a start, Chinese production is in fact very highly standardised and modern. There are so many people in China that Labour is cheap, and so many companies are realising this and setting up shop there....

One thing I will say about Behringer is they have outstandung customer service. Their products are well manufactured, For the price you pay

No-one can deny that in terms of value for money, Behringer is a company above all the rest.

and lets not forget Behringer brings technology to those that could not previously afford it.....
